Description
SAIC is seeking an Information System Security Manager (ISSM) to perform cybersecurity functions in support of information technology (IT) systems at Wright Patterson AFB in OH.
This is a Hybrid-Remote position. Candidates must be local to Dayton, OH, but will only need to be on base at WPAFB two (2) days per week.
Candidate attributes, duties, and responsibilities include:
- Be self-motivated and establish solid working relationships with clients and the clients’ customers.
- Conduct cybersecurity, vulnerability, and compliance assessments of clients’ networks, systems, and applications.
- Use COTS, GOTS, other tools, processes, and procedures to conduct Security Test and Evaluations (ST&Es) and scans to identify, contain, mitigate, and remediate vulnerabilities.
- Validate security controls are implemented correctly and recommend additional operational risk mitigations and safeguards. Review, audit, and monitor risk mitigations from start to finish.
- Assist clients in fulfilling their security awareness programs. Support the development, maintenance and reporting of cybersecurity metrics.
- Prepare and present briefings to senior staff.
Qualifications
- Bachelors and nine (9), master’s and seven (7) or relevant years of experience in lieu of degree.
- US Citizen and possess active Top Secret Clearance
- Possess an active DoD Information Assurance Manager II (IAM II) certification (e.g., CASP, CISSP, CISM)
- Working knowledge of:
- Enterprise Mission Assurance Support Service (eMASS)
- Assured Compliance Assessment Solution (ACAS)
- Risk Management Framework (RMF)
